Seongnam City, Gyeonggi Province (Mayor Shin Sang-jin) announced on the 1st that it will provide up to 2.5 million KRW in support to companies participating individually in domestic exhibitions in 2025 to expand domestic and international sales channels for small and medium-sized enterprises and revitalize the local economy.
The city is recruiting 60 companies to participate in the ‘2025 Domestic Exhibition Individual Participation Support Project’ by the 11th.
The support target is small and medium-sized enterprises that individually participate in exhibitions held domestically from January to December 2025, must have their headquarters or factories located in Seongnam City, and must not receive duplicate support from other institutions.
The city will comprehensively evaluate past support history, marketing capabilities, product competitiveness, and select support targets. The support items include booth rental fees, basic installation costs, promotional expenses, online exhibition participation fees, and other exhibition participation costs, with up to 2.5 million KRW supported per company.
The total project budget is 150 million KRW, and the project will be operated by entrusting it to the Seongnam Industry Promotion Agency. The support funds will be paid retrospectively by claiming to the Seongnam Industry Promotion Agency after participating in the exhibition.
A Seongnam City official stated, “We plan to provide various opportunities so that local small and medium-sized enterprises can quickly respond to the latest technology trends and market changes.”
◆ Seongnam City to Hold ‘Fighting Seongnam! Concert’ 17 Times Across the Region
Seongnam City announced on the 1st that it will hold the ‘Fighting Seongnam! Concert,’ which brings cultural and artistic performances to various locations across the region, 17 times this year.
The first Fighting Seongnam Concert will be held on the 5th from 4:00 PM to 5:30 PM at the outdoor performance venue in Beolteosan Sujin Park (the 8th scenic spot), one of the nine cherry blossom paths.
This location was chosen to present a fantastic stage amid fluttering petals timed with the peak cherry blossom season.
On that day, the Seongnam City Boys and Girls Choir will perform songs such as ‘Growing Pains,’ ‘Cherry Blossom Trip,’ and ‘If the World Becomes a Song.’
Following that, the Seongnam City Gugak Orchestra will perform ‘Beautiful Memories,’ ‘The Wind Blows,’ and ‘Orbit of Delusion’ using traditional instruments such as daegeum, haegeum, and ajaeng. A percussion performance will also be held to enhance the excitement.
Five vocal and dance teams from the Youth Professional Arts Group, selected through an open audition by Seongnam City, will also perform, presenting shows like ‘I am a Firefly,’ ‘Love Battery,’ and ‘Korean Pop (K-POP) Medley Dance.’
Subsequent Fighting Seongnam Concerts will be held at △ Unjung Middle School in Bundang-gu on April 12 △ Gaenari Park in Sangdaewon High-Tech Valley, Jungwon-gu on April 19 △ Hwarang Park in Bundang-gu on April 26. The Seongnam City Symphony Orchestra, Seongnam Youth Professional and Got Talent Arts Groups will perform, and all concerts are free of charge.
The city plans to select this year’s performance locations mainly in areas where concerts were not held last year, so that more citizens can enjoy a variety of repertoires outdoors near their homes.
